Ebenezer & James Scudder 1829

In Memory of
Master Ebenezer & Capt James Scudder
sons of Capt James D & Mrs Hannah Scudder.

These two promising young men
were on board the sloop Caroline when she struck
on Collier's Ledge Feb 20, 1829
with other survivors committed themselves to their boat
and landed on Sampson's Island the ensuing day
where Master Ebenezer after suffering a few hours
perished with the cold Feb 21, 1829
aged 13 years 8 months & 14 days.
Capt James survived until they reached the schooner Gold Hunter
then lying near the island where he died a few minutes after
being worn out by exertion Feb 21, 1829
aged 19 years 8 months & 8 days.

Stop, stop young brother sailors
On this stone cast your eye
Although today in youth and health
Tomorrow you may die.
